Transaction 61e2c808536564825d3ffba40504ae416ced7efd277cc8f45b2fed5475711d0d
1 Input
1 Output
-
61e2c808536564825d3ffba40504ae416ced7efd277cc8f45b2fed5475711d0d:0
- value
- 44610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2c7f83f5bfe9ce33f649e4a28c43813c64d9f9b OP_EQUAL
- address
- 3Ppj177a8dptB5qprNXkZKFVLn3KPYunnV